NOMAD II Yacht Description

The spaciously designed layout reveals innovative architecture where every detail has been planned to create a warm, homely atmosphere. With her new visual identity, rigging and hull design, she provides increased performance, comprising a unique brand signature. Indeed, Nomad II's elegance seduces thanks to the bevelled shape of her hulls, generous volumes and panoramic views, more than ever enhanced.
A flybridge with two secure accesses and a helm station provides perfect visibility. And behind the helm station, a huge modular recreation area conceals a storage area large enough to store all the cushions.
A large open cockpit facing out to sea, large stern skirts enable easy access to the boat and a large modular dining area with removable bench seats to welcome children and adults alike.
A second cockpit for further enjoyment of the foredeck with dual function: seating or deck chair position, flush with the forward trampoline.

Advertised by DMA Yachting, the impressive charter yacht NOMAD II is a 50 ft sailing catamaran. NOMAD II spends the summer and winter season in Greece. She was delivered by the ship builder Lagoon in 2020. The ingenious yacht layout features 6 cozy cabins and comfortably accommodates a maximum of 10 guests.

NOMAD II is offered primarily as a sailing catamaran. The the heart of the yacht is the main saloon, which connects to the aft deck. The aft deck features a variety of seating areas and that's where most of the meals are served. The modern cabins are located in the 2 massive hulls. The cabins are located below the main saloon, connected by stairs (inquire about handicapped access). Multiple portholes connect you with the outside world.

The sailboat features 2 x 80 CV / 2 x 80 HP Generator Onan Water Maker engines and a generator.

NOMAD II Yacht Charter Price

# of charter days Base Price APA (deposit for provisioning, fuel, docking fees, etc) Taxes: 12%, exceptions available Total Note
14 day charter 29,000€ to 37,000€ 5,800€ to 11,100€ 3,480€ to 4,440€ 38,280€ to 52,540€ Discounts outside the main season are common.
7 day charter 14,500€ to 18,500€ 2,900€ to 5,550€ 1,740€ to 2,220€ 19,140€ to 26,270€ Standard charter rate, base for all calculations.
3 day charter 7,250€ to 9,250€ 1,450€ to 2,775€ 870€ to 1,110€ 9,570€ to 13,135€ The usual formula is the 7 day charter rate divided by 6, times the number of days (3).
Boat policy might differ.
14,500€ / 6 * 3 days = 7,250€

All prices are generated by a calculator and serve as a guide for new charterers. Any additional information of the Price Details section has priority over above. Availability is always subject to confirmation. Gratuity not included for it's discretionary character, usually 5%-25% of the Base Price.

Crew

Crew Information

Crew of NOMAD II|Captain Captain

Crew of NOMAD II|Cook/Hostess Cook/Hostess

Captain: George Margaritis

Captain: George Margaritis

Captain George, a seasoned maritime professional, completed his education at Nautical High School in Piraeus and has been navigating the seas with expertise ever since. Born in 1976, he brings a wealth of experience to the helm of Nomad II. His maritime journey began as a deckhand, and over the years, he has ascended to the role of captain on various yachts. With a comprehensive understanding of nautical operations, Captain George ensures the smooth sailing and safety of Nomad II. Fluent in both Greek and English, he seamlessly communicates with his crew and international guests and caters to every need. He is hard working, professional and a great team leader! Captain George's dedication to maritime excellence together with his extensive background make him an invaluable leader aboard Nomad II, providing his guests with an unforgettable and enjoyable sailing experience.


Cook/Hostess: Stephanie Berton
Born in 1977 in France, Stephanie has been an integral part of the yachting industry since 2006. Beyond her prowess in yacht management and hospitality, she brings a unique dimension to the team as a certified yoga instructor, aligning mind and body wellness with her charter expertise.
Fluent in Spanish, English, French, and Italian, Stephanie effortlessly communicates with diverse cultures and guest nationalities making everyone feel comfortable and welcome on board immediately! Her commitment to health consciousness extends beyond linguistic versatility, as she specializes in crafting Mediterranean and nutritious culinary experiences, catering to the well-being of both guests and crew.
Known for her bright, talented, and self-motivated demeanor, she boasts a commendable track record of consistently impressing customers. With a resourceful approach to problem-solving, she adds value to any crew and ensures a memorable yachting experience.
